嵌入式开发
文章平均质量分 66
「已注销」
这个作者很懒,什么都没留下…
展开
-
UART的知识
UART: Universal Asynchronous Receiver/Transmitter,通用异步接收/发送装置,UART是一个并行输入成为串行输出的芯片,通常集成在主板上,多数是16550AFN芯片。因为计算机内部采用并行数据,不能直接把数据发到Modem,必须经过UART整理才能进行异步传输,其过程为:CPU先把准备写入串行设备的数据放到UART的寄存器(临时内存转载 2010-03-08 13:10:00 · 792 阅读 · 0 评论 -
关于 UINT32 x:y的意义
用位域结构把32位减去8位就可以了(其实还是占32位.不过后面8位无效)struct bb{UINT32 a:24;};bb.a就是24位 这种用法很老了 和以下是等效的: struct yourtype{ byte c[3];};这个概念很老了作一些底层硬件方面的工作那就应该有用吧原创 2010-04-07 17:25:00 · 963 阅读 · 0 评论 -
TCP的KeepAlive
TCP keep-alive & connection pool<br />要理解TCP keep-alive/persistent connection, 得从TCP协议说起。<br />TCP flow: _____ _____ | | | | | A |原创 2010-07-12 22:37:00 · 1173 阅读 · 0 评论 -
TCP Keep-Alive Messages
TCP Keep-Alive Messages(2010-05-19 09:31:23)标签:it分类:socket<br />From:MSDN<br />A Transmission Control Protocol (TCP) keep-alive packet is an acknowledgment (ACK) with the sequence number set to one less than the current sequence number for the connection.转载 2010-07-12 22:37:00 · 2260 阅读 · 0 评论 -
回调函数实例
<br />回调函数是由用户撰写,而由操作系统调用的一类函数,回调函数可以把调用者和被调用者分开,调用者(例如操作系统)不需要关心被调用者到底是哪个函数,它所知道的就是有这么一类函数,这类满足相同的函数签名(函数原型,参数,返回值等),由用户书写完毕后在被调用就可以了。实现上回调函数一般都是通过函数指针来实现的。 <br />典型的回调函数是MFC 下的定时器处理函数ontimer,你只需要添加这个消息响应函数,然后在初始化的时候将ontimer指针传递给操作系统,操作系统就会按照设定好的时间来循环调用on原创 2010-07-13 17:15:00 · 726 阅读 · 0 评论 -
Android Development Notes-2
Summary:SDK, ADB, Active, Intents and Tasks原创 2015-05-02 17:00:37 · 908 阅读 · 0 评论 -
Android development Notes-3(Activity, Intents, and Tasks, Service, Content provider)
-Android introduces a richer and more complex approach by supporting multiple application entry points. Android programs should expect the system to start them in different places, depending on where原创 2016-02-26 23:05:38 · 1458 阅读 · 1 评论 -
Android Development Notes-4(BroadcastReceiver, Manifests)
Summary: BroadcastReceiver, Manifests, Delvik VM, Zigote -A broadcast receiver receives the action of Intent objects, similarly to an Activity , but does not have its own user interface -A typical原创 2016-06-22 23:15:52 · 543 阅读 · 1 评论